We had a delicious pre-theatre meal at the Northall. The staff were very friendly, helpful and efficient and catered for all our needs even though my friends arrived late.
Excellent service, very good food and good value (3 courses + champagne for £35). Style a little old-fashioned and formal, but that was expected. Tiny wrinkle - slow to sort out paying the bill when we were in a hurry to get to the theatre.
